The chemical roles of lanthanides in biology are increasingly recognized, yet remain largely unexplored. Unlike most lanthanides, cerium is redox-active and readily adapted for chemical transformation. Herein, we report a cerium-mediated oxidative thiol–ene coupling between cysteine-derived thiols and styrenes under aqueous conditions, yielding β-hydroxysulfide products. Building on this reactivity, we developed a site-selective cysteine modification strategy using a 17-amino acid cerium-binding sequence. Only cysteines optimally positioned near the vacant coordination site undergo efficient and rapid labeling, particularly with electron-deficient styrene derivatives. This work demonstrates cerium-mediated biological activity and highlights its potential as a reactive center for site-selective bioconjugation and broader biochemical and synthetic applications.

Chemical Science is a journal that encompasses various disciplines within the chemical sciences. Its scope includes publishing ground-breaking research with significant implications for its respective field, as well as appealing to a wider audience in related areas. To be considered for publication, articles must showcase innovative and original advances in their field of study and be presented in a manner that is understandable to scientists from diverse backgrounds. However, the journal generally does not publish highly specialized research.
